97 points Vinous

The 2018 Bettina is a regal wine. Bright floral and spice accents lend energy to the red-toned fruit. As always, Bettina is a Cabernet Sauvignon-based blend from the estate and several David Abreu sites, in this vintage Madrona Ranch, Bryant and Thorevilos. Healthy dollops of Merlot, Cabernet Franc and Petit Verdot add notable layers of complexity. Iron, sage, dried leaves, tobacco and red-toned fruit linger. (Drink between 2026-2043) (AG, 01/2022)

95+ points Wine Advocate

The 2018 Bettina Bryant Proprietary Red Wine is a blend of 65% Cabernet Sauvignon, 18% Merlot, 4% Cabernet Franc, 18% Malbec and 13% Petit Verdot. It was aged in French oak, 75% new, and bottled in July 2020. This year there was a small amount of stem inclusion with the Cabernet Franc fermentation. Very deep purple-black colored, it opens with beautiful spice and floral notions of cinnamon, cloves, lavender and roses over a core of black and red currant jelly, Morello cherries and boysenberries with a waft of dusty soil. Medium to full-bodied, the palate is very tightly wound with firm, fine-grained tannins and lovely freshness, finishing long and mineral laced. 580 cases were made. (LPB, 11/2020)
